Propolis, a kind of natural products, was used to fight against pathogenic microorganism invasion. Propolis has a lot of biological compounds and a variety of pharmacological properties. The antioxidant property is one of its most important pharmacological properties. It’s great significance that research on activity ingredient identification and antioxidant property of propolis. Therefore, in this paper, including components analysis and antioxidant property of propolis from China was studied. A variety of antioxidant methods and cell model of in vitro antioxidant was used to conduct a comprehensive evaluation. Studying the relationship between the antioxidant property and components of propolis, and compared the differences of different methods.Using raw propolis from 85 areas of China as material, total phenolics and total flavonoids content in extracts of propolis by 75% ethanol-water were estimated and the preliminary qualitative and quantitative analysis of components in extracts of various regions was done by using HPLC, and the propolis was classificated based on composition and content of propolis. The contents of total polyphenols and flavonoids of propolis collected from different areas varies, Hunan province has highest total phenolics and total flavonoids content in extracts, with 319.77mg/g raw propolis. By identifying the components in extracts, we found that 6 kinds of flavonoids, which were pinobanksin-3-O-acetate, chrysin, pinocembrin, pinobanksin,galangin,5-methoxy pinobanksin,with high content in extracts of mostly raw propolis. Caffeic acid phenethyl ester, P-coumaric acid, caffeic acid and isoferulic acid have higher content in extracts of mostly raw propolis compared with other kinds of phenolic acids and their esters. Propolis from the Chinese mainland was divided into five categories based on HPLC chromatography figure features, most of them belonged to previous three categories. Class A has highest total phenolics and total flavonoids content in extracts, with 184.74mg/g raw propolis.Propolis from the Chinese mainland extracted with water,75% ethanol-water, petroleum ether, ethyl ether, ethyl acetate. The comprehensive antioxidant capacities of the hydrophilic and lipophilic extracts of propolis were evaluated by ORAC assay and anion radical scavenging activity. The antioxidant properties of propolis extracted with different extraction solvent listed from strong to weak as follows:75% ethanol-water extract>diethyl ether extract, ethyl acetate extract>water, petroleum ether extract. And the antioxidant properties of five categories listed from strong to weak as follows:A>B, C, D>E. The antioxidant capacities of propolis extracts showed strong positive correlation with the total polyphenol content. The antioxidant capacity of propolis is enhanced with increasing polyphenol content.The antioxidant activities of different extracts of propolis were investigated by cell-based antioxidant methods used flow cytometry, fluorescence microplate reader and fluorescence inverted microscope. The results showed that all extracts of propolis had strong antioxidant activities. And propolis extract in Heilongjiang baoqing had the strongest cellular antioxidant activity.
